How is molar mass determined using colligative properties?
You can calculate the molecular mass using freezing point depression or boiling point elevation using the formula: mols solute= change in BP (or FP) x kg solvent / Kb (or Kf) /i
Where Kb and Kf are constants and i is number of ions (or 1 if covalent)
Then take mols solute (calculated) and divide into grams solute (recorded)

What is alkali metals and alkali earth metals?
Alkali metals are in the first column of the periodic table, but do not include Hydrogen.
The alkali metal family is composed of Lithium, Sodium, Potassium, Rubidium, Cesium and Francium.
An example of an alkali metal is Sodium (Na).

How are period and group trends in atomic radii are related to electron configuration?
Period trends in atomic radii show a decrease across a period due to increasing nuclear charge and more protons pulling electrons closer. Group trends in atomic radii show an increase down a group due to additional energy levels being added, leading to larger atomic size. Electron configuration influences these trends by determining the number of energy levels and electron shielding in an atom, affecting the distance of the outer electrons from the nucleus.

What is the maximum number of electrons each of the following can hold... 2s 5p 4f 3d 4d?
2s: 2 electrons
5p: 6
4f: 14
3d: 10
4d: 10
Why where the lanthanide and actinide elements droped out of order on the periodic tabel?
The vertical columns of the periodic table are arranged to contain elements that have similar chemical and physical properties.
The two rows at the bottom (called the Lanthanide and Actinide series) are elements that would all fit into group IIIB, in periods (horizontal rows) 6 and 7. since there is only one spot on the chart for all the elements in each series, they are listed separately at the bottom of the table.
